易语言dm.ocr识字返回的字符串“1234”,怎么分割出来?

作者&投稿:贲杰 (若有异议请与网页底部的电邮联系)
~

如果易语言dm.ocr识字返回的字符串是"1234",想要将其分割成单个数字,可以使用字符串的遍历和切片操作来实现。具体操作如下:

1、遍历字符串

    使用循环遍历字符串中的每个字符,可以使用 for 循环和字符串的 len() 和 [] 操作符来实现:


  • Dim str As String

  • str = "1234"

  • For i = 1 To Len(str)

  •    Print Mid(str, i, 1)

  • Next


  • 以上代码中,Len(str) 返回字符串 str 的长度,Mid(str, i, 1) 返回字符串 str 中从第 i 个字符开始的一个字符。

    2、使用切片操作

    使用字符串的切片操作可以将字符串分割成单个字符,可以使用 for 循环和字符串的 len() 和 Mid() 操作符来实现:

  • Dim str As String

  • str = "1234"

  • For i = 1 To Len(str)

  •    Print Mid(str, i, 1)

  • Next


  • 以上代码中,Mid(str, i, 1) 返回字符串 str 中从第 i 个字符开始的一个字符。

    无论使用哪种方法,以上代码都将字符串 "1234" 分割成了单个数字 "1"、"2"、"3"、"4" 并打印输出。可以根据实际需求选择适合自己的方法。




按键大漠区域识别字体中 颜色和色偏 能否设置为变化的
你是说在界面中通过变量更改吗?A=dm.Ocr(50,50,300,300,“C1-D1|C2-D2”&变量,0.7)

传奇按键精灵脚本怎么判断死亡
dm_ret = dm.BindWindow(hwnd,"normal","normal","normal",0)\/\/设置字库(字库的生成,在大漠插件中有详细说明)dm.SetPath "C:\\"dm_ret = dm.SetDict(0, "test.txt")\/\/这个就是要识别的字所在的位置 s = dm.Ocr(1020,29,1130,43,"dedbde-000000",1.0)If s <> "比奇县" Then...

大漠插件+按键精灵识别完数字如何让它写到指定位子
把这个数字放到剪贴板,到了指定位置先单击再粘贴不就OK了??剪贴板可以看作是操作系统内,跨程序的系统变量。

我想用扫描机把药品都输入进去,现在用的哪个软体呀?
求安卓手机能用的扫描输入法软体。 云脉OCR识别安卓版 扫描药品电子监管码软体 这个软体好像是新大陆开发的,你去买扫描药品监管码的资料采集器,问下厂家有没有软体卖就好了。福州新联付DM08二维扫描平台全相容扫描一维码二维码手机支付条码。有哪个软体能把扫描的文字识别代替打字输入? OCR汉字识别软...

如何把pdf转成word
2.1 页数比较少的用 CAJviewer 7.0 (带OCR组件完整版) ,支持直接打开PDF文件,识别文字。2.2 页数比较多的可以用 Readiris Corporate 12软件来进行识别 (需要安装亚洲语言包,不然不识别中文)2.3 页数比较多的还可以用 ABBYY finereader 9或者9以上版本(有简体中文版)进行识别转换。这个...

易语言循环怎么返回
编辑框1.内容 > 0 这样也能成立吗?一个文本型,一个整数型,你连这些都没写好,怎么往下走?到整数 (编辑框1.内容) > 0 这样才成立. 你先把这些都搞好了,再问吧。

请问按键精灵是怎么把下面识别到的这个a和b的结果相加的??
你的ab里面的值是字符类型的,所以相加变成12的字符串。你要实现数字相加,需要用CLng函数将字符转换成数字,最后一句改成CLng(a)+CLng(b)

什么是机器视觉?可以用来做什么
1、什么是机器视觉?答:根据我在广东粤为工业机器人学院学习的知识所知:机器视觉就是用机器代替人眼来做测量和判断。机器视觉系统是指通过机器视觉产品(即图像摄取装置,分 CMOS 和CCD 两种)将被摄取目标转换成图像信号,传送给专用的图像处理系统,得到被摄目标的形态信息,根据像素分布和亮度、颜色等...

学vc++游戏编程需什么基础?
首先你要会,windows下程序的运行原理,会windows窗口应用程序设计,写windows窗口应用程序:a最常用的就是MFC编程 b或用platform sdk (也就是windows api)MFC是对windows api的类封装。然后你就可以写扫雷,五子棋这样的程序了。如果你想写那种网游里的效果。那就路漫漫了。找本directX的书看看吧。用...

DELL 2330dtn详细技术参数
打印机支持89种可扩展的PS3\/PCL字体,包括OCR-A、OCR-B和Code 39条形码,以及2种点阵化PCL字体。它的接口类型多样,包括高速USB 2.0端口,以及并行IEEE-1284和10\/100BaseT RJ-45以太网连接,兼容MS Windows 2008 Server、Windows 2003 Server等操作系统,以及RH Linux、WS SuSE Linux和NetWare等网络...

洮南市13554143728: 易语言调用大漠怎么得到找字返回的坐标 -
诸葛富麝香: //ocr不是那么用的,ocr只能识字,懂吗,识字,还得是你事先放在字库里的字. //用大漠综合工具做字库,再用findstr来找字库里的做好的那个字, dm_ret = dm.FindStr(0,0,2000,2000,"长安","9f2e3f-000000",1.0,intX,intY) If intX >= 0 and intY >= 0 Thendm.MoveTo intX,intYdm.LeftClick End If

洮南市13554143728: 按键精灵变量与变量相除 -
诸葛富麝香: 大漠找字的返回值是string字符串,而不是数字,所以不能直接计算,需要用cdbl命令进行转换:A=cdbl(A)B=cdbl(B)Z=B/A这样就可以啦,希望我的回答对你有帮助!^o^

洮南市13554143728: 谁能教我OD破解易语言做的软件啊,我要查找里面的字符串 -
诸葛富麝香: 给你说下怎么找字符串点暂停后面那个文件夹图标 打开易语言 载入就是这个样子了 然后 插件里面选这个查找ASCII 如果没加壳的话 你就顺利看见字符串了 要破解的话你还得学很多东西的 慢慢来.

洮南市13554143728: 易语言在指定位置输出字符串 -
诸葛富麝香: 写到文件(d:\123.txt,到字节集(“fe:dsfsdff;()”)) 要打开就加下面的 打开指定网址(“d:\123.txt”)

洮南市13554143728: 易语言如何给文本型变量赋值一个含有"的字符串. -
诸葛富麝香: 易语言自带常量:#引号可以直接用这个.比如说想在编辑框内容写 我不是“笨蛋” 代码如下:编辑框1.内容=“我不是”+#引号+“笨蛋”+#引号分享本回答由电脑网络分类达人 董辉认证...

洮南市13554143728: 易语言识字坐标返回问题!!!为什么会提示错误(10044): 不能将“双精度小数型”数据转换到“文 -
诸葛富麝香: 源码乱的,我估计是这里 文本 =到文本(识字坐标返回 (0, 0, 2000, 2000, “登陆”, “fefefe-303030”, 1))满意请采纳哦,祝您玩得愉快!~

洮南市13554143728: 易语言取汉字内容 -
诸葛富麝香: .版本 2.支持库 OPenGL.程序集 窗口程序集1.子程序 __启动窗口_创建完毕 输出调试文本 (取双字节中文字符 (“123我的4554我的的到底”)).子程序 取双字节中文字符, 文本型.参数 取出文本, 文本型.局部变量 a, 文本型.局部变量 x, ...

洮南市13554143728: 易语言如何取字符串最后的几个字符
诸葛富麝香: 你好,这个要用指针变量来做,操作如下: #inclucde<stdio.h> void main(){char *a="填字符串";a=a+N;printf("%s\n",a);} 这里的N是指你从第N个字节开始复制.你要的变量会存在a里面.

本站内容来自于网友发表,不代表本站立场,仅表示其个人看法,不对其真实性、正确性、有效性作任何的担保
相关事宜请发邮件给我们
© 星空见康网